Improving software engineering teaching by introducing agile management

One of the main goals of Software Engineering (SE) courses is to train students to face problems that occur in professional contexts. Thus, software engineering courses have to be continuously reoriented to cater for the demands of the software industry without neglecting academic quality. The wides...

Descripción completa

Guardado en:
Detalles Bibliográficos
Autores principales: Soria, Alvaro, Campo, Marcelo R., Rodríguez, Guillermo
Formato: Objeto de conferencia
Lenguaje:Inglés
Publicado: 2012
Materias:
Acceso en línea:http://sedici.unlp.edu.ar/handle/10915/123880
Aporte de:
id I19-R120-10915-123880
record_format dspace
institution Universidad Nacional de La Plata
institution_str I-19
repository_str R-120
collection SEDICI (UNLP)
language Inglés
topic Ciencias Informáticas
Software engineering education
Scrum
Agile Coaching
spellingShingle Ciencias Informáticas
Software engineering education
Scrum
Agile Coaching
Soria, Alvaro
Campo, Marcelo R.
Rodríguez, Guillermo
Improving software engineering teaching by introducing agile management
topic_facet Ciencias Informáticas
Software engineering education
Scrum
Agile Coaching
description One of the main goals of Software Engineering (SE) courses is to train students to face problems that occur in professional contexts. Thus, software engineering courses have to be continuously reoriented to cater for the demands of the software industry without neglecting academic quality. The widespread use of Scrum, an agile approach to software development, provides SE professors with a suitable option for teaching students good practices of current software development. In the present paper, we introduce a teaching model based on a combination of Scrum and Agile Coaching. This innovative model, which has been contrasted with RUP (Rational Unified Process) and assessed, using CMMI (Capability Maturity Model Integration) as a reference, is a result of an evolutionary process in which several improvements were conducted during the academic period 2008/10. Results show that this agile approach allows students to develop software achieving high levels of CMMI maturity.
format Objeto de conferencia
Objeto de conferencia
author Soria, Alvaro
Campo, Marcelo R.
Rodríguez, Guillermo
author_facet Soria, Alvaro
Campo, Marcelo R.
Rodríguez, Guillermo
author_sort Soria, Alvaro
title Improving software engineering teaching by introducing agile management
title_short Improving software engineering teaching by introducing agile management
title_full Improving software engineering teaching by introducing agile management
title_fullStr Improving software engineering teaching by introducing agile management
title_full_unstemmed Improving software engineering teaching by introducing agile management
title_sort improving software engineering teaching by introducing agile management
publishDate 2012
url http://sedici.unlp.edu.ar/handle/10915/123880
work_keys_str_mv AT soriaalvaro improvingsoftwareengineeringteachingbyintroducingagilemanagement
AT campomarcelor improvingsoftwareengineeringteachingbyintroducingagilemanagement
AT rodriguezguillermo improvingsoftwareengineeringteachingbyintroducingagilemanagement
bdutipo_str Repositorios
_version_ 1764820450450341888